Common Recipe for Hawaiian pizza
Ingredients:
- 1 pre-made pizza dough (about 12 inches in diameter)
- 1/2 cup (120ml) tomato pizza sauce
- 2 cups (200g) shredded mozzarella cheese
- 8 ounces (225g) cooked ham, sliced into small squares
- 1 cup (165g) pineapple chunks, drained
- 1 tablespoon (15ml) olive oil
- 1/2 teaspoon (1g) dried oregano
- 1/4 teaspoon (1g) cr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
- Fresh basil leaves, for garnish (optional)
- Cornmeal, for dusting the baking sheet
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 475°F (245°C). If you have a pizza stone, place it in the oven to preheat as well.
- On a lightly floured surface, roll out the pizza dough to a 12-inch circle. If using a baking sheet, dust it with cornmeal to prevent sticking.
- Transfer the rolled-out dough onto the prepared baking sheet or a pizza peel if using a pizza stone.
- Spread the tomato pizza sauce evenly over the dough, leaving a small border around the edges for the crust.
- Sprinkle the shredded mozzarella cheese over the sauce, ensuring even coverage.
- Distribute the ham slices and pineapple chunks evenly over the cheese layer.
- Drizzle the olive oil over the toppings, then sprinkle with dried oregano and crushed red pepper flakes if using.
- Carefully transfer the pizza onto the preheated pizza stone or place the baking sheet in the oven.
-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Remove from the oven, let cool for a few minutes, and garnish with fresh basil leaves if desired. Slice and serve warm.
Notes:
For a crispier crust, bake the pizza directly on a preheated pizza stone. If you prefer a sweeter taste, use fresh pineapple instead of canned. Leftover pizza can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heated in the oven for best results.
